Step-by-step explanation:
<u>Basic Concept: Geometry</u>
<u>Formula:</u>
<u>Area of a polygon = </u>
<u></u>
where p = perimeter and a = apothem
In this problem we are given the area and the apothem and we need to find the perimeter
To do so we want to plug what we are given into the formula and solve for the missing piece.
We are given the area (350) and the apothem (10)
So in the formula we would plug in 350 for the area and 10 for "a"
We would then have

<u>Basic Concept: Algebra</u>
Now we use basic algebra to solve for p (perimeter)
step 1 multiply each side by 2

now we have 700 = 10p
Step 2 divide each side by 10
700/10=70
10p/10=p
we're left with p = 70
So we can conclude that the perimeter is equal to 70
